# Ampaire Lands $19M to Certify a Hybrid Engine That Cuts Regional Fuel Burn by More Than Half

Ampaire, a Long Beach, California company developing hybrid-electric propulsion for regional aircraft, has raised US$19 million in a Series B round led by DiamondStream Partners, bringing total funding to US$68 million. The round drew two airline corporate venture arms: Alaska Star Ventures, backed by Alaska Air Group, and IAGi Ventures, the investment vehicle of International Airlines Group, parent of British Airways and Iberia. Other participants include Techstars Ventures, the Autodesk Foundation Impact Fund, the Los Angeles Cleantech Incubator Impact Fund, Elemental Impact, Pay it Forward Ventures, Massive Ventures, Venn10 Capital, Gaingels, Exit Fund, Sand Hill Angels, and Climate Capital.

The company, led by co-founder and chief executive Kevin Noertker, builds the AMP-H570, an integrated-parallel hybrid-electric power system, and the Eco Caravan, a retrofit of the Cessna Grand Caravan using that system. Rather than designing a new airframe, Ampaire replaces the propulsion system on aircraft already certified and in service. Flight testing shows the Eco Caravan burning 54% to 57% less fuel than the Pratt & Whitney Canada PT6A engine it replaces, with the AMP-H570 turbodiesel delivering roughly 50% savings in cruise and up to 70% when battery power handles takeoff. Ampaire has accumulated more than 38,000 hybrid-electric test flight miles. The funding will support Part 33 engine certification targeted for late 2027, followed by Part 23 supplemental type certification for the Eco Caravan, along with expanded engineering teams, supplier readiness, early manufacturing, and aftermarket support. The company is also developing hybrid-electric auxiliary power units with IAG to cut fuel consumption while aircraft sit on the ground. ## Market Context

The round lands in a sector that has been contracting rather than expanding. Lilium, the German electric jet developer, ended operations in 2026 with its prototypes going unsold; fellow German eVTOL company Volocopter entered bankruptcy proceedings; Netherlands-based hybrid-electric developer Maeve Aerospace failed despite backing from Delta Air Lines, SkyWest, and Japan Airlines; and hydrogen-electric startup ZeroAvia cut its workforce in half and saw founder Val Miftakhov step down after eight years as chief executive. Analysts describe the sector's core problem as high risk, long timelines, limited returns, and a requirement for capital far beyond what most rounds provide.

Ampaire's positioning is deliberately less ambitious, and that is the argument for it. Certifying a new aircraft from scratch takes many years and enormous capital, which is what exhausted several of its peers. Modifying the propulsion on an already-certified airframe through a supplemental type certificate is a narrower regulatory path with a defined precedent, and the target customer is regional operators for whom fuel is a dominant and volatile cost. The participation of Alaska Air Group and IAG matters for the same reason: airline venture arms invest where they can foresee an actual purchase, not only a technology thesis.

## Regional Relevance

**For the United States:** Ampaire operates from Long Beach, part of Southern California's aerospace corridor, and its path runs directly through the Federal Aviation Administration, whose certification decisions will determine whether hybrid-electric propulsion reaches commercial service this decade. Regional aviation matters disproportionately in the United States, where small operators connect communities that larger carriers do not serve and where fuel costs can decide whether a route stays viable. Alaska Air Group's involvement is notable given the carrier's dependence on short regional routes in terrain where alternatives to flying are limited, making a 50% reduction in fuel burn an operating question rather than an environmental one.

**For Europe and global aviation:** IAG's participation extends the technology toward European commercial aviation, where emissions regulation is stricter and carriers face mandated sustainable aviation fuel blending and carbon costs that US airlines do not yet bear to the same degree. The auxiliary power unit work with IAG targets fuel burned on the ground, a category that applies to every large aircraft regardless of route and offers savings without touching the propulsion of the main fleet. For operators in markets where regional aviation is essential infrastructure rather than a convenience, retrofit economics are more relevant than new aircraft programs most carriers cannot afford.

## The Other Side

**Is US$19 million enough to reach certification?** Total funding stands at US$68 million against Part 33 certification targeted for late 2027 and a supplemental type certificate after that. Aircraft certification routinely costs more and takes longer than projected, and the companies that failed in this sector generally did so between demonstration and certification rather than at the technical stage. Ampaire will almost certainly need to raise again before the first commercial delivery.

**How much do the fuel savings figures depend on conditions?** The 54% to 57% reduction is measured against a specific baseline engine, and the 70% figure applies only when battery power handles takeoff, a phase that represents a small share of a flight. Savings across a full route depend on stage length, payload, and how often batteries can be recharged between flights, and the company has not published route-level operating economics.

**Does airline venture backing signal orders?** Alaska Star Ventures and IAGi Ventures investing is meaningful validation, but corporate venture arms take small positions to observe technology as often as to commit to purchasing it. Ampaire has not disclosed firm orders, letters of intent, or delivery commitments from either airline, and the distinction between an investor and a customer is the one that determines whether the company reaches scale.
